Sooners Dominate Bama
The Sooners scored in the first inning as Trey Gambill doubled home two runs. In the third, Deiten LaChance grounded into a double play, but it brought home a run. In the sixth, LaChance was at it again, this time with a two-run home run. Oklahoma would tack on four more runs in the eighth to make it 9-0 as they shut out Alabama. Cord Rager went seven scoreless innings, allowing three hits, no walks, and striking out eight.
Georgia Sends Texas to Eliminate Game
In the bottom of the first, Rylan Lujo hit a two-run home run. The Bulldogs would get two more runs on a wild pitch in the inning. Texas would get on the board in the top of the fifth with an RBI single from Ethan Mendoza. In the seventh, Lujo doubled home a run, and Kenny Ishikawa singled home two more to make it 7-1, and that was the final. Joey Volchko pitched a complete game, allowing one run on four hits. He walked one and struck out 15. Dylan Volantis for Texas went 6.1 innings, allowing seven runs, two earned on four hits, one walk, and nine strikeouts.
